Skill Advisor

Search, compare, and install skills correctly to preferred agents.

Installation Workflow

Copy this checklist and track progress:

Skill Installation:
- [ ] Step 1: Search with multiple keywords
- [ ] Step 2: Preview and read SKILL.md
- [ ] Step 3: Compare and categorize (High/Medium/Low)
- [ ] Step 4: Generate install commands (no --all!)
- [ ] Step 5: Verify installation

Step 1: Search Skills

Search with multiple related keywords for better coverage:

npx skills find QUERY
npx skills find RELATED_QUERY

Step 2: Preview and Read SKILL.md

Preview each repository's available skills:

npx skills add owner/repo -g --list

Read actual SKILL.md content at:

https://skills.sh/owner/repo/skill-name

Never rely solely on skill names. Names can be misleading.

Step 3: Compare and Recommend

Evaluate each skill:

DimensionWeight
Content quality (scripts, references, actionable workflows)High
Coverage systematics (coherent skill system from same author)High
Tech stack matchHigh
Source authority (Official > Org > Individual)Medium
Maintenance activityMedium
Function overlapMedium

Quality criteria:

  • High: Scripts, detailed references, concrete examples, actionable workflows
  • Medium: Useful guidance but mostly text-based
  • Low: Generic content, replaceable by general LLM knowledge

Step 4: Generate Install Commands

CRITICAL: Never use --all flag — it overrides --agent and installs to ALL 39 agents.

Rules:

  1. Only generate install commands for High quality skills
  2. Medium quality: list in Optional section, commands provided separately
  3. Low quality: no install commands

Correct pattern:

npx skills add owner/repo -g -s skill1 -s skill2 -a antigravity -a claude-code -a gemini-cli -a opencode -y

Parameters:

FlagMeaning
-gGlobal install (user-level)
-s SKILLSpecify skill (repeat for multiple)
-a AGENTTarget agent (repeat for multiple)
-ySkip confirmation
-lList available skills only
--allDANGER: Installs all skills to all agents

Wrong vs Right:

# WRONG — --all overrides -a, installs to ALL agents
npx skills add expo/skills -g -a claude-code --all

# RIGHT — explicit -s and -a flags
npx skills add expo/skills -g -s xlsx -s pdf -a antigravity -a claude-code -a gemini-cli -a opencode -y

Step 5: Verify Installation

# List installed skills
npx skills ls -g

# Check symlinks exist
ls -la ~/.claude/skills/
ls -la ~/.gemini/skills/
ls -la ~/.gemini/antigravity/skills/
ls -la ~/.config/opencode/skills/

# Verify no unwanted directories
ls ~/.cursor/ ~/.cline/ 2>/dev/null

Default Target Agents

Agent--agent valueGlobal Path
Antigravityantigravity~/.gemini/antigravity/skills/
Claude Codeclaude-code~/.claude/skills/
Gemini CLIgemini-cli~/.gemini/skills/
OpenCodeopencode~/.config/opencode/skills/

For all 39 supported agents, read references/agents.md.

Common Pitfalls

  1. --all flag: Overrides --agent, installs to 39 agents, creates unwanted directories
  2. Forgetting -g: Installs to project only
  3. Missing -s: May install all skills or prompt interactively
  4. Trusting skill names: Always read SKILL.md content
